Jami Rogers, MS, LAT, ATC is an experienced Licensed Athletic Trainer with a career spanning over a decade in various athletic and health-focused roles. Currently serving at ThedaCare since May 2015 and as a Personal Trainer at the YMCA of the Fox Cities since August 2017, Jami previously held significant positions including Head Athletic Trainer and NCAA DIII Baseball Championship Medical Coordinator at Lawrence University, where responsibilities included managing athletic training services for multiple teams, staff supervision, and medical coordination. Additional experience includes serving as a Graduate Assistant Athletic Trainer at St. Cloud State University, and early roles in aquatics and event management. Jami holds a Bachelor of Arts in Athletic Training and Spanish from Northern Michigan University and a Master of Science in Sports Management from St. Cloud State University.

For more than a century, ThedaCare has been committed to finding a better way to deliver serious and complex healthcare to patients throughout northeast Wisconsin. The organization serves over 235,000 patients annually and employs more than 7,000 healthcare professionals throughout the region. ThedaCare has seven hospitals located in Appleton, Neenah, Berlin, Waupaca, Shawano, New London and Wild Rose as well as 35 clinics in nine counties. ThedaCare is the first in Wisconsin to be a Mayo Clinic Care Network Member, giving our specialists the ability to consult with Mayo Clinic experts on a patient’s care. ThedaCare is a non-profit healthcare organization with a level II trauma center, comprehensive cancer treatment, stroke and cardiac programs as well as a foundation dedicated to community service.
